How they compare
Comoros currently reports 0.0003 units per person against 0.0003 units per person in Congo, a difference of 0 units per person.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Congo ahead.
Comoros ranks 149th and Congo ranks 151st of 186 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Comoros averaged higher in 1 and Congo in 3.

About this data
Employment (ILO modelled estimates)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
